Dajove Service Support Nigeria Limited delivers technology-driven electrical, civil and facility support services for Nigeria's oil and gas operators — built on discipline, safety, and work that speaks for itself.
Established in 2012, Dajove Service Support Nigeria Limited has grown into a trusted name across Nigeria's oil and gas services landscape — specialising in technology-driven, customer-focused engineering support for operators working some of the region's most demanding sites.
Our work sits at the intersection of electrical installation, perimeter security infrastructure, and civil field support — the unglamorous, mission-critical work that keeps terminals, flow stations and gantries running safely.

Four capability areas built from direct site experience across flow stations, pipelines and terminal infrastructure.
Transformer and feeder panel installation, switchgear termination, armoured cable laying and cable tray systems.
Electrified fencing with integrated intrusion detection and prevention systems for high-value terminal perimeters.
Cable trenching, earthing, underground armoured cable termination, and pipeline dig-up verification support.
